Analysis
In 2024, share of the population using improved water sources wash in Jamaica stood at 98.05. That is the highest value across all 25 years on record.
The figure is up 0.2% on the previous year and up 1.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, share of the population using improved water sources wash in Jamaica peaked at 98.05 in 2024 and was at its lowest, 93.97, in 2000.
Jamaica ranks 129th of 224 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 94.78 | 93.97 | 95.56 | 10 |
| 2010s | 96.5 | 95.74 | 97.25 | 10 |
| 2020s | 97.73 | 97.41 | 98.05 | 5 |
